Ingredients for Strawberry Crunch Bars

  • 1 cup crushed strawberries: Fresh strawberries add bright, tangy notes. Frozen strawberries can be substituted, though you may encounter slight variations in texture.
  • 1 cup cream cheese, softened: This ingredient provides a rich and creamy base. For a lighter version, opt for Neufchâtel cheese.
  • 1/2 cup powdered sugar: Sweetness binds the mixture together. Feel free to adjust the sweetness according to your preference.
  • 1 cup whipped cream: Make it from scratch or use store-bought for convenience. Unsweetened whipped cream allows you to control sweetness levels.
  • 1 cup vanilla wafer crumbs: The buttery flavor gives a delightful crunch. You can swap with graham cracker crumbs for a different taste.
  • 1/2 cup butter, melted: Butter intensifies the flavor and helps bind the crumb layer. Margarine is an acceptable substitute.
  • 1/2 cup strawberry cake mix: This component adds a fun, enhanced strawberry flavor, but you can use white cake mix or leave it out if desired.
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ar: Just a touch enhances the sweetness and balances the overall flavor.

How to Make Strawberry Crunch Bars

Creating your Strawberry Crunch Bars unfolds in delightful steps:

  1. In a mixing bowl, combine 1 cup of softened cream cheese with 1/2 cup of powdered sugar. Beat until the mixture turns smooth and creamy. This base sets the stage for luscious creaminess.

  2. Gently fold in 1 cup of whipped cream and 1 cup of crushed strawberries. Be careful not to deflate the whipped cream too much; this mixture should be light and airy.

  3. In a separate bowl, mix 1 cup of vanilla wafer crumbs, 1/2 cup of melted butter, 1/2 cup of strawberry cake mix, and 1/4 cup of granulated sugar. Stir until crumbly. The texture should resemble wet sand, ready to provide a perfect crunchy layer.

  4. Press half of the crumb mixture firmly into the bottom of an ungreased 9×9-inch baking dish. This crust forms the foundation of your bars, so tamp it down well.

  5. Spread the strawberry cream cheese mixture on top of the crust evenly. Allow a little of the crust to peek through, but aim for a generous layer.

  6. Sprinkle the remaining crumb mixture over the top of the strawberry layer. This gives you that sought-after crunch element that contrasts beautifully with the creamy filling.

  7. Freeze your bars for at least 4 hours or until they are firm and set. Though it may be tempting, patience is essential for achieving the right texture.

  8. Once firm, remove the bars from the freezer and cut them into squares. Enjoy the results of your labor—satisfying layers just waiting to be devoured!

Chef’s Notes & Helpful Tips

  • To make ahead, prepare the bars the night before and let them chill in the freezer overnight. They retain their flavor and texture beautifully.
  • If you’re short on time, opt for store-bought whipped cream to save on preparation.
  • For a twist, consider adding a hint of lemon zest to the cream cheese mixture for a bright, citrusy punch.
  • Experiment with graham cracker crumbs or even chocolate wafer crumbs to switch up the flavor profile.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Overbeating the mixture: Gently fold the whipped cream; overmixing can lead to a dense texture instead of the airy quality you want.
  • Not letting the bars freeze long enough: Patience is key! A longer freeze helps the layers solidify and makes cutting easier.
  • Using soupy strawberries: Ensure your crushed strawberries are well-drained before adding them to prevent excess moisture in the bars.

Storage & Reheating Instructions

Keep your Strawberry Crunch Bars in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 5 days. When freezing, wrap them tightly in plastic wrap and place them in an airtight container for up to 2 months. They retain their quality when stored correctly; simply thaw them in the refrigerator before serving. Don’t worry about reheating; these bars are best enjoyed cold.

FAQs

Can I use other fruits besides strawberries?
Absolutely! Ripe diced peaches, crushed raspberries, or blueberries will work beautifully. Just remember to adjust for sweetness levels if you swap fruits.

Can I use low-fat cream cheese?
Yes, low-fat cream cheese works fine, but it may slightly alter the rich texture. You might notice a less creamy mouthfeel but still delightful!

What can I do if my bars are too soft after freezing?
If they remain overly soft, try freezing them a bit longer or checking if your freezer is set to the right temperature.

Is this recipe suitable for a gluten-free diet?
You can certainly make this gluten-free. Swap regular vanilla wafers for gluten-free versions, and be sure to verify the other ingredients are gluten-free.

Can I add toppings to these bars?
Yes! Drizzling melted chocolate or adding chopped nuts makes for a delightful finish. Fresh whipped cream on top or a sprinkle of coconut could also add an exciting touch.
